Villa Albertini
Villa Albertini is a building in Negrar di Valpolicella, Verona, Veneto. Villa Albertini is situated nearby to the village Arbizzano, as well as near Saint Peter church.Places of Interest Nearby

Villa Serego
Manor estate
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Villa Serego or Villa Sarego is a Palladian villa at Santa Sofia di Pedemonte, San Pietro in Cariano in the province of Verona, northern Italy. It was built for the aristocratic Sarego family, and designed by Italian Renaissance architect Andrea Palladio. Villa Serego is situated 1½ km west of Villa Albertini.
